By facilitating an environment where creativity could thrive, Matassa enabled artists to break new ground and transcend previous musical boundaries.
J&M Studio became the crucible for this transformative process. The tracks laid down within its walls captured the essence of New Orleans, merging traditional sounds with burgeoning rock ‘n’ roll influences. Matassa’s ability to balance technical precision with artistic expression created a new genre that was both innovative and deeply rooted in the cultural tapestry of the region.
Moreover, Matassa’s impact wasn’t confined to his era alone. Modern musicians and producers continue to draw inspiration from the recordings he produced, seeking to emulate the organic, unpolished sound that came to define a generation. His techniques, while grounded in the mid-20th century, remain relevant in today’s digital age, where authenticity in music is often highly prized.
In sum, Cosimo Matassa’s role in shaping New Orleans music cannot be overstated. His commitment to authenticity and passion for his craft not only propelled numerous artists to fame but also entrenched the city’s status as a musical powerhouse. Through every note and melody that emerged from J&M Studio, Matassa’s influence endures, a testament to his indelible mark on the world of music.
